Steven Cohen is the founder of Point72 Asset Management and previously built SAC Capital into one of the industry’s most profitable trading firms. Point72 operates a multi-manager platform combining fundamental long/short equity with systematic and other strategies. Cohen is also a major figure in sports ownership and philanthropy, while remaining one of the most closely followed names in hedge fund trading culture.

Steven Cohen's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, Steven Cohen held 4,738 positions worth $90.7B, up 16% from $78.1B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 11% of the portfolio.

Steven Cohen withdrew a net $3.54B in Q2 2026, closing 815 positions and reducing 1,446 holdings. Its most notable exit was Parker-Hannifin, an estimated $250M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 21% of assets, up from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Steven Cohen opened a new position in Texas Instruments worth $410M.

  • Steven Cohen's largest Q2 2026 buy was Texas Instruments: 1,377,090 shares worth $410M.
  • Steven Cohen added most to Snowflake in Q2 2026, an estimated $497M increase.
  • Steven Cohen's biggest Q2 2026 reduction was NVIDIA, cutting an estimated $1.47B.
  • Steven Cohen fully exited Parker-Hannifin in Q2 2026, selling an estimated $250M.
  • Steven Cohen's ten largest holdings make up 11% of its $90.7B portfolio in Q2 2026.
  • Steven Cohen opened 1,048 new positions and closed 815 in Q2 2026.
  • Steven Cohen's portfolio value rose 16% quarter-over-quarter to $90.7B.

Based on Point72 Asset Management's 13F filing for Q2 2026, filed 14 Aug 2026.
